Most insurance plans call for high deductibles and co-pays and if you had a serious injury, you know how the co-pays and deductibles can add up to. Even if you have the best insurance, you are sure to pay much for a tour of the hospital, a fortiori the cost of taking leave of being in the hospital.

Most people in Michigan who were lucky to have health insurance find what it causes financial difficulties. The cost of healthcare in this country is spike. Employers are passing the cost of health insurance to its employees deductions higher salary, co-pays and large franchises. Costs, and quality assurance plan keeps going down.

The good news is that medical debt can be placed in your medical faillite.Dette is a non-guaranteed debt, which means that you do not conditioned an asset (warranty) for debt.As with any non-guaranteed debt, which can be removed in a chapter 7 or reduced for cents on the dollar in a chapter 13.Votre medical debt will be treated the same as your credit card debt.So if you have this Bill $15,000.00 hospital, it may be taken in charge of your bankruptcy.You shouldn't have to fall sick with worry about how you will pay your medical debts.
